The Greek word pharmakon means which of the following? 
a. Medicine 
b. Poison 
c. Remedy 
d. Medicine, poison, and remedy 
ANS: D 
Rationale: The word pharmakon refers to the curing of illness, thus meaning medicine and 
remedy, as well as poison because early medicines were toxic enough to kill a patient or 
enemy.
